Century is a town in Escambia County, in the Pensacola-Ferry Pass metro area.
The community was named for construction of a local lumber mill, which began at the beginning of the 20th century
The latitude of Century is 30.973N. The longitude is -87.263W.
It is in the Central Standard time zone. Elevation is 85 feet.The estimated population, in 2003, was 1,783.

At the time of the 2000 census, the per capita income in Century was $10,412, compared with $21,587 nationally.
5% of Century residents age 25 and older have a bachelor's or advanced college degree.

Median rent in Century, at the time of the 2000 Census, was $198. Monthly homeowner costs, for people with mortgages, were $561.

The average commute time for Century workers is 29 minutes, compared with 26 minutes nationwide.
